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ations
Purpose and placement determine the right mirror door type. Over-the-door mirrors maximize space and are ideal for renters or rooms where wall alterations aren’t possible, while sliding closet doors offer seamless integration with larger wardrobe spaces.
Material and safety are critical. Look for tempered or safety-backed glass to reduce shattering risk, and copper-free or distortion-minimized mirrors to ensure accurate reflection. Frames should be sturdy enough to withstand daily use, with tracks and rollers designed for quiet operation and long-term reliability.
Installation and fit matter. Measure door width, closet opening, and wall-to-door clearance before purchase. Over-the-door options should fit the door thickness and height without obstructing movement, while sliding doors require compatible rail systems and wall space.
Durability versus aesthetics. Steel frames provide durability and a modern look, while aluminum alloys keep weight down for easier handling. Consider the finish and color to match existing furniture and decor, ensuring the mirror enhances light reflection without overpowering the room’s design.
Maintenance and safety features. Explosion-proof backings, safety film, and copper-free mirror options contribute to long-term safety. Regular cleaning with non-abrasive methods preserves clarity, and protective packaging can help prevent damage during shipping and installation.
